A superlative adjective is an adjective we use to compare three or more things to pick out one thing that is more ''something" than the others.eg adjective tall - Martin is the tallest in the class.For longer adjectives (more than one syllable) we use most.eg adjective famous - Martin is the most famous in our family.
The comparative adjective of "plump" is "plumper." It is used to compare the fullness or roundness of two or more subjects. For example, you might say, "This apple is plumper than that one."
